fix: 更新多条步骤数据状态

This commit is contained in:
chenwenjian 2025-04-17 14:31:47 +08:00
parent 5b49d57da9
commit fd7d79b260

View File

@ -128,8 +128,11 @@ public class GuideTenantProcedureStatusServiceImpl extends ServiceImpl<GuideTena
log.info("步骤已完成无需重复操作workspaceId: {}, procedureId{}", req.getWorkspaceId(), req.getProcedureId());
return;
}
tenantProcedure.setStatus(req.getStatus());
updateById(tenantProcedure);
lambdaUpdate()
.eq(GuideTenantProcedureStatus::getWorkspaceId, req.getWorkspaceId())
.eq(GuideTenantProcedureStatus::getProcedureId, req.getProcedureId())
.set(GuideTenantProcedureStatus::getStatus, req.getStatus())
.update();
}
@Override